OFFER DESCRIPTION

We are looking for a candidate to manage and coordinate the full lifecycle of research projects within the BSC’s Project Management Office (PMO), with a focus on coordinated projects of the centre’s Computer Science Department, particularly the ones related to the European Processor Initiative. The position will report to the Computer Sciences Senior Project Manager.

 

Key Duties

  • Project Coordination. Establish a good relationship with the project partners, follow and coordinate project activity and reporting. Carefully plan the use of resources and monitor the progress of work, anticipate possible problems using a risk register and maintain excellent communication with the Principal Investigators and with the EC Project Officer. Keep track of budgets and effort spent. Organize and participate in consortium meetings, teleconferences, reviews and other events. Prepare and submit high quality periodic reports on time (collect and review consortium information). Ensure compliance with contractual obligations including budget and schedule and help to resolve possible disputes between partners. Represent the PMO at project reviews.
  • Proposal Management. Take the lead on the definition and writing of the management section of coordinated project proposals and coordinate contributions from other partners regarding use of resources, budget, project governance etc. Contribute to other sections of the proposal where needed, including the impact section. Ensure that administrative requirements of proposals are met (eligibility etc.).
  • Contract Management. Take the lead in negotiating, supervise the drafting and signing process of contracts (consortium agreements, NDAs, grant agreements, contracts with companies etc.) ensuring that the interests of the BSC and its researchers are protected.
  • Others. Collaborate to improve the operation of the PMO by sharing best practice.
